📚 What is the Primary Purpose of Law in Society?

The primary purpose of law in society is multifaceted, serving as the bedrock for maintaining order, resolving disputes, protecting individual rights, and promoting the general welfare. Law provides a framework for acceptable behavior, ensuring a degree of predictability and stability in social interactions.

📜 History and Background of Legal Systems

The concept of law dates back to ancient civilizations. Early legal codes, such as the Code of Hammurabi in Mesopotamia, aimed to establish consistent rules and punishments. Over time, legal systems evolved, influenced by philosophical, religious, and political thought. Roman law, for example, significantly shaped the legal structures of many European countries. The development of common law in England, based on precedent and judicial decisions, further contributed to the diversity of legal systems worldwide. Today, legal systems vary widely but share common goals of justice and social order.

⚖️ Key Principles of Law

  • 🛡️ Protection of Rights: Laws safeguard fundamental human rights, including freedom of speech, religion, and assembly.
  • 🤝 Maintaining Order: Laws establish rules of conduct to prevent chaos and promote peaceful coexistence.
  • 🏛️ Establishing Standards: Laws set benchmarks for behavior in various aspects of life, from business transactions to environmental protection.
  • Resolving Disputes: Laws provide mechanisms for settling disagreements through courts and alternative dispute resolution methods.
  • Promoting Social Welfare: Laws aim to improve society by addressing issues like poverty, inequality, and public health.
  • Ensuring Justice: Laws seek to provide fair and equitable outcomes for all members of society.

🌍 Real-World Examples of the Law in Action

Consider these scenarios:

ScenarioLegal Principle
A contract dispute between two businesses.Contract law provides a framework for enforcing agreements.
A person accused of theft.Criminal law defines the offense and sets out the process for prosecution and defense.
A company polluting a river.Environmental law regulates activities that impact the environment.
A family seeking a divorce.Family law governs marriage, divorce, and child custody.

💡 Conclusion

In conclusion, the primary purpose of law in society is to create a structured and just environment where individuals and institutions can interact predictably and peacefully. By protecting rights, maintaining order, resolving disputes, and promoting the general welfare, law serves as an essential tool for building a thriving and equitable society.
